Output c54e3508920a6f1b2713b459c1550f77852004a370b8abe8538bd6134acf86db:2

value
13621430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6290a0d5224dafe67e5605333f003d04aacb056d OP_EQUAL
address
3AgBQHnhupES3DSgmQEUFsSc46vzVPqoEP
transaction
c54e3508920a6f1b2713b459c1550f77852004a370b8abe8538bd6134acf86db
confirmations
462112
spent
true